We are urgently seeking surveyors for a range of clients including corporate firms, national panel managers, regional firms and independent, bespoke practices. All provide surveyors with a mix of flexibility, generous packages and accessible leadership – allowing for a sensible work-life balance and the potential for excellent bonuses.

Tip Number 1

Network with professionals in the surveying field. Attend industry events or join online forums where you can connect with other surveyors and learn about potential job openings.

Tip Number 2

Research the companies you're interested in. Understand their values, projects, and work culture to tailor your approach and show how you can contribute to their success.

Tip Number 3

Consider reaching out directly to hiring managers or team leaders at firms you're interested in. A personal touch can make a big difference and show your genuine interest in their work.

Tip Number 4

Stay updated on industry trends and technologies. Being knowledgeable about the latest developments in surveying can set you apart from other candidates and demonstrate your commitment to the profession.
